Robertson County History Museum

Springfield, TN

The museum, located in the former U.S. Post Office, showcases the unique history of the county, including its tobacco and whiskey past. 

Directions: Accessible from I-24 and I-65. On entering Springfield, proceed to the historic Robertson County Court House on the Public Square. Museum is adjacent to the Court House.
